5082 Aluminum vs. ZK40A Magnesium

5082 aluminum belongs to the aluminum alloys classification, while ZK40A magnesium belongs to the magnesium alloys.

For each property being compared, the top bar is 5082 aluminum and the bottom bar is ZK40A magnesium.
